Description

Wire model specification caliber
Technical Field
The invention relates to the technical field of measuring devices, in particular to a wire model specification measurer.
Background
With the continuous development of power systems, the original data of part of old lead models may be lost, or the stored data may not be matched with the actual line model obviously, or cannot be confirmed, so that power personnel often need to update and collect data of the power grid transmission and distribution line.

Preferably, the body is made of an epoxy laminated glass cloth sheet. The main part is made by epoxy laminated glass cloth board, ageing resistance, corrosion-resistant, long service life, and insulating properties is strong to the safety of personnel is gathered for measuring provides the guarantee.
Preferably, the insulation rod connecting head is made of stainless steel materials. The insulating rod connecting head is made of stainless steel materials, so that the connection stability is guaranteed, and the use convenience is also guaranteed.

Drawings
Fig. 1 is a front view of the present invention.
Figure 2 is a top view of the present invention.
Fig. 3 is a schematic diagram of the use of the present invention.
Figure 4 is a cross-sectional view of the spacing device of the present invention.
Fig. 5 is a sectional view of the rotating shaft device of the present invention.
Illustration of the drawings: 1-insulating rod connector, 2-mounting block, 3-main body, 4-fastening bolt, 5-adjusting block, 6-sliding groove, 7-clamping rod, 8-caliper, 9-rotating shaft device, 10-operating block, 11-placing groove, 12-measuring groove, 13-indicating block, 14-sliding rod, 15-ejection spring, 16-ejection hole, 17-rotating shaft, 18-expansion layer, 19-air storage cavity, 20-air guide hole, 21-positioning block, 22-external threaded rod, 23-internal threaded hole, 24-piston, 25-reset spring, 26-expansion cavity and 27-clamping hole.
Detailed Description
The technical scheme of the invention is further specifically described by the following embodiments and the accompanying drawings.
Example 1:
as shown in figures 1, 2, 3 and 4, a wire model specification measurer comprises an insulating rod connector 1 and a main body 3 with a placing groove 11, wherein the main body 3 is made of epoxy laminated glass cloth, and is anti-aging, corrosion-resistant, long in service life and strong in insulating property, so that the safety of measurement and collection personnel is guaranteed, the insulating rod connector 1 can be directly connected with a common insulating operating rod for use, the insulating rod connector 1 is made of stainless steel materials, not only the connection stability is guaranteed, but also the use convenience is guaranteed, the insulating rod connector 1 is fixed at one end of the main body 3 through an installation block 2, the installation block 2 is fixed on the main body 3 through a fastening bolt 4, the connection is stable, the disassembly and replacement are very convenient, a rotating shaft device 9 is rotatably connected to one side of the main body 3, which is far away from the insulating rod connector 1, and a plurality of calipers 8 are rotatably connected on the rotating shaft, the caliper rule 8 is stored in a placing groove 11 when not in use, the caliper rule 8 can rotate along a rotating shaft device 9, a plurality of measuring grooves 12 with different sizes are arranged on the caliper rule 8 along the length direction, an indicating block 13 used for displaying the size of each corresponding measuring groove 12 is arranged on each caliper rule 8 corresponding to each measuring groove 12, the indicating block 13 can record the size of each corresponding measuring groove 12 or data of a measuring lead, the identifying and recording of workers are facilitated, a limiting device is arranged on a main body 3 corresponding to each caliper rule 8 and can prevent the caliper rule 8 from moving randomly, the limiting device comprises a sliding groove 6 arranged on the main body 3, a sliding rod 14 is arranged in the sliding groove 6, an operating block 10 used for driving the sliding rod 14 to move is arranged at one end, far away from the main body 3, of the sliding rod 14, an ejecting hole 16 is arranged at the bottom of the sliding groove 6 corresponding to the caliper rule 8, and a clamping rod 7 positioned, one end of the clamping rod 7, which is far away from the sliding rod 14, extends out of the ejection hole 16, one end of the caliper 8, which is far away from the rotating shaft device 9, is provided with a clamping hole 27 corresponding to the clamping rod 7, an ejection spring 15 is arranged between the sliding rod 14 and the side wall of the sliding groove 6, when the caliper 8 is not used, a worker needs to put the caliper 8 into the placing groove 11, the worker firstly moves the operating block 10, so that the operating block 10 can drive the sliding rod 14 to move in the sliding groove 6 after overcoming the spring force of the ejection spring 15, the sliding rod 14 can drive the clamping rod 7 to move simultaneously when moving, so that the clamping rod 7 cannot influence the movement of the caliper 8, when the caliper 8 is placed in place in the placing groove 11, the worker loosens the operating block 10, so that the sliding rod 14 moves under the action of the ejection spring 15, the sliding rod 14 can drive the ejection rod to move simultaneously when moving, and the ejection rod can enter the corresponding clamping hole 27, therefore, the caliper rule 8 is limited, the caliper rule 8 is prevented from rotating randomly, when a worker needs to use a proper caliper rule 8, the worker moves the operation block 10 corresponding to the caliper rule 8 to relieve the limitation on the caliper rule 8, the operation is very convenient, and the plurality of caliper rules 8 are provided with a plurality of measurement grooves 12 of different sizes, so that the worker can measure a lead accurately; the staff links to each other main part 3 and insulating bar through insulator spindle connector 1, then selects suitable slide caliper rule 8 after, and the handheld insulating bar of rethread is measured the wire, and measurement efficiency is high.
